Which lymphatic tissue destroys and removes old red blood cells?.

Health
2 answers:
Yakvenalex [24]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The spleen.

Explanation:

The spleen not only destroys and removes old red blood cells, but it also removes debris from the bloodstream, protects lymphocytes, and acts as a resivoir for blood!

A ductless vascular gland that destroys old red blood cells, removes debris from the bloodstream, acts as a reservoir of blood, and produces lymphocytes. white pulp: The part of the spleen where lymphocytes are maintained in a similar way as in lymph nodes.
